#425058 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#425058 is composed of 25.9% red, 31.4%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25% cyan, 9.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 201.8 degrees, a saturation of 14.3% and a lightness of 30.2%. #425058 color hex could be obtained by blending #84a0b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#425058
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#07090a is the darkest color, while #fdfef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#425058
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#484e52 is the less saturated color, while #016299 is the most saturated one.
